Abstract

In the last five years the development of numerical methods for systems of hyperbolic conservation laws has advanced dramatically. This changed the concept of what is considered to be a solution. The first time ever since 1757 when Euler developed his equations for gas dynamics can one now show convergence of numerical solutions to solutions of these equations. Starting from basic knowledge in the field these new schemes are presented.

The series of lectures has to be seen in connection with the Workshop on Numerical Methods for Hyperbolic Conservation and Balance Laws and Applications 10-11 November 2017.
